Won one!! :thumbsup: My 360 is from 2003 and so predates Euro 4. Frustrating since my V5 actually shows an NoX level which meets the Euro 4 standard as well as the other two levels. Unforunately the LAs go on date of manufacture and the appeals system didnt work. I was repeatedly asked for a manufacturers certificate of conformity so thet " the dvla records can be updated". And this depite sending scans of the V5 which showed that the DVLA had the data already. Catch 22. Until now at last :
"Based on the information available on your vehicle's DVLA record, I can confirm that your vehicle is compliant with the minimum emissions standards for Clean Air Zones, and your vehicle is not subject to Clean Air Zone charges.
I have requested for your record to be updated to reflect this.
This will be updated within 2 working days. Please check back on the Vehicle Checker before your next journey into or within the Clean Air Zone.
Please be aware, if you intend to drive into or within the zone before this has been updated, you will still need to pay for the journey. When this has been updated, you can contact the Local Authority for a refund.
Do not reply to this email. If you wish to contact us again about this response then please use our reply form link"
Somehow I doubt that it will work abroad but it will do in the UK until they start replacing Euro 4 as a requirement by Euro 5 or 6.
The records you need to get altered if you are in the same position are at the DVLA cazsupport@dvla.gov.uk
